The Oklahoma City Thunder secured a decisive 123-87 victory over the Los Angeles Lakers on Tuesday at Crypto.com Arena. Rookie Dalton Knecht, the 17th overall pick in the 2024 NBA draft, made his debut for the Lakers, tallying five points and four rebounds. Knecht previously played for Tennessee, where he averaged 21.7 points per game during the 2023-24 season. However, the Lakers were without star players LeBron James and Luka Doncic for this matchup. Rui Hachimura was the leading scorer for Los Angeles with 15 points, supported by Drew Timme's 11 points. The Lakers' next game is scheduled for Thursday against the Golden State Warriors in San Francisco.
